In better detail, CVD diamond development normally takes area inside of a vacuum chamber filled with a hydrogen and carbon-containing gas, like methane. A supply of Electrical power �?like a microwave beam �?breaks down the fuel molecules, as well as carbon atoms diffuse towards the colder, flat diamond seed CVD Diamond Crystal plates. Crystallization takes place around a duration of weeks, and several crystals grow at the same time.

The fluorescence of artificial diamonds is additionally normally valuable for identification. Artificial diamond fluorescence is commonly more robust less than limited-wave than underneath lengthy-wave ultraviolet light-weight, although the other is real of normal diamonds that fluoresce. Synthetic diamond fluorescence also normally happens in a particular sample.
The true problem, On the subject of diamond identification, is pinpointing very small diamonds referred to as melee. Melee is bought from the jewelry trade in parcels of hundreds to A large number of gemstones. Some parcels may include the two natural and CVD/HPHT developed artificial diamonds.
With all the rising electricity density and diminished dimension in the GaN-primarily based Digital ability converters, the heat dissipation within the devices will become The crucial element challenge toward the actual applications. Diamond, with the best thermal conductivity amid all of the purely natural components, is of the curiosity for integration with GaN to dissipate the created heat through the channel on the AlGaN/GaN high electron mobility transistors (HEMTs). Recent procedures include 3 procedures to fabricate the GaN-on-diamond wafers: bonding of GaN with diamond, epitaxial development of diamond on GaN, and epitaxial progress of GaN on diamond. Due to the massive lattice mismatch and thermal mismatch, The mixing of GaN-on-diamond wafer is experienced from stress, bow, crack, rough interfaces, and enormous thermal boundary resistance.
